That Critical First Bite: Puppy Food Timeline

Most folks don't realize newborn pups get zero nutrition from actual food. Seriously, their bellies can't handle solids. Mom's milk is their lifeline for weeks. But around week 3-4, magic happens:

Puppy AgeDietHuman Equivalent
0-3 weeksMother's milk onlyNewborn drinking formula
3-4 weeksMilk + gruel introductionToddler trying mashed bananas
5-6 weeksIncreasing solid foodEating soft finger foods
7-8 weeksFull solid mealsRegular kid meals

Funny thing - puppies don't care what the calendar says. Their bodies scream cues. Watch for these signs:

  • Those needle teeth popping through gums (hurts Mom during nursing)
  • Puppies becoming walking furballs instead of crawling
  • Observing Mom eat with intense curiosity (my Aussie pup stole broccoli from my plate at week 5!)

Breed-Specific Variations

Not all pups hit milestones together. Big breeds develop slower:

Breed SizeAverage Start Eating FoodSpecial Considerations
Toy (Chihuahua, Yorkie)3-3.5 weeksNeed extra-small kibble, prone to hypoglycemia
Medium (Beagle, Cocker)3.5-4 weeksStandard transition works best
Giant (Great Dane, Mastiff)4.5-5 weeksSlower digestion, mush longer

My neighbor's Great Dane pup actually needed gruel until week 7. Vet said it's normal - their jaws take longer to develop strength.

Creating Puppy Gruel: Do's and Don'ts

Gruel isn't just soggy kibble. Mess this up and you'll get diarrhea city. Here's how breeders actually do it:

Gruel Recipe That Works

  • Dry puppy kibble (soak in warm puppy milk replacer 20 mins)
  • Ratio: 1 part kibble to 3 parts liquid (use replacer, not cow milk!)
  • Texture: Should drip slowly from spoon (like oatmeal)

Warning: Cow milk causes upset tummies in 70% of pups according to my vet. Use puppy-specific milk replacer instead.

Transitioning to Solids: Week-by-Week

WeekFood TextureFeeding FrequencyWhat I Learned
3-4Runny gruel4x daily by shallow dishPups will walk through it. Baths required.
5Thick mush (oatmeal)4x dailyAdd less liquid gradually
6Moistened kibble3-4x dailyCrunchy bits should appear
7-8Dry kibble3x dailyAlways have fresh water available!

Emergency Scenarios: When Things Go Wrong

Sometimes nature needs backup. Here's when to intervene:

Signs of Trouble During Weaning

  • Diarrhea lasting >24 hours (common with sudden food changes)
  • Refusing all food for >12 hours
  • Excessive crying after eating

I once fostered an orphaned litter that rejected every commercial puppy milk. Turned out they needed goat colostrum. Saved three pups.

Orphaned Puppy Protocol

No mom? Timeline accelerates:

  • Week 1-2: Bottle feed milk replacer every 2-3 hours
  • Week 3: Introduce gruel by syringe or finger-swipe
  • Week 4: Offer gruel in shallow dish 5x daily

Top Puppy Food Mistakes (I've Made Them All)

After raising 14 puppies, here's my hall of shame:

MistakeConsequenceBetter Approach
Switching brands suddenlyVomit + diarrhea parade7-day gradual transition
Overfeeding "just a bit"Potbelly + joint stressMeasure portions with scale
Using adult dog foodNutritional deficienciesAlways puppy-formulated

Fun fact: Puppies need twice the calories per pound than adults! But their stomachs are tiny walnuts. Hence frequent meals.

FAQs: Your Top Questions Answered

When exactly should puppies start eating solid food?

Most start between 3-4 weeks. But "solid" means mush initially. True dry kibble comes weeks later.

How do I know if my puppy is ready for food?

Watch for: - Teeth eruption (little needles!) - Following mom to food bowl - Chewing on siblings (ouch)

Can you start a puppy on dry food?

Not immediately. Their jaws can't crunch hard kibble until 6-7 weeks. Start with soaked versions.

What if my breeder sends puppy home with adult food?

Red flag! Puppies need: - Higher protein (22-32%) - More fat (10-25%) - DHA for brain development Adult food lacks these.

Nutrition Deep Dive: Beyond Kibble

Commercial puppy food works, but options exist:

Food TypeProsConsVet Rating
Dry KibbleConvenient, dental benefitsLow moisture content★★★★☆
Wet FoodHydrating, palatableExpensive, messy★★★☆☆
Raw DietNatural ingredientsBacterial risk, unbalanced★★☆☆☆
Home-CookedControl ingredientsNutritionally incomplete★★★☆☆

My take? Kibble + occasional wet food toppers works best for most. Raw diets scare me after a parasite outbreak at our local kennel.

Essential Nutrients Puppies Need

  • Protein: 22-32% for muscle (look for named meats)
  • Calcium: 1-1.8% for bones (too much harms joints)
  • DHA: Omega-3 for brain development

Cheap foods bulk with corn and soy. Your pup will eat more but get less nutrition. Worth splurging here.

Troubleshooting Picky Eaters

Got a pup turning nose at food? Try:

  • Warming food to release aromas
  • Hand-feeding first few bites
  • Toppers like bone broth or goat milk

But never: - Force-feed - Swap foods constantly - Add human junk food

My terrier mix refused to eat for 18 hours once. Vet said "He'll eat when hungry." She was right. Patience won.

Sample Feeding Schedule (Realistic Version)

Puppy AgeMeals Per DayPortion Size Guide
8-12 weeks4 times1/4 - 1 cup total (varies by breed)
3-6 months3 timesIncrease by 10% weekly
6-12 months2 timesAdult portion guidelines

Portion sizes shock people. My friend's Golden pup needed 3 cups daily at 4 months! Check your food's calorie chart.
